Wall Mounted Electric Fireplaces

A wall mounted electric fire is a great option for any space. They can be recessed into the walls or hung on the walls.

Most wall mounted electric fireplaces come with an element of heating that generates supplemental heat for the room. They can be controlled using remote or control panel controls.

Size

Generally speaking, wall-mounted electric fireplaces are available in different sizes to suit various rooms. The size of your electric fireplace will be contingent on a variety of variables that include the dimensions of your room as well as the depth of your walls.

In general, shallower electric wall hung fires fires work best in smaller spaces whereas deep models are suitable for larger areas. However, the most important aspect is to determine how much heat is needed in the space in which the fireplace will be installed. The majority of fireplaces come with different temperature settings that can allow you to determine the perfect amount of warmth for your home.

Most wall-mounted electric fire places are designed to be flush or recessed into the wall. It is suggested to hire an expert for the latter, as it requires cutting a portion of the wall in order to allow for the installation. In contrast, a flush-mounted model is able to be put on the wall like any other piece of furniture.

There are a variety of freestanding electric fire places available for those who prefer a classic appearance. Some have a mantelpiece and frame that gives them the look of a real fireplace. Some have a long design that fits under a TV.

While freestanding electric fireplaces offer a more traditional style, they do not produce as much heat as other alternatives. There are, however, wall-mounted electric fireplaces which can provide a pleasant level of additional heat for rooms with a maximum of 300 square feet.

One of the most well-known options is the Allusion It is available in a variety of frame finishes. It can be either partially or fully recessed in a 2x6 framed wall, and looks as polished on the the wall as any other piece of furniture. It's even possible to build a surround for this kind of fireplace, though it's usually not necessary. Scion Trinity is one of the latest electric fireplaces available. The multi-sided design does away with the need for an enclosure which makes it one of the simplest to install. Additionally, it provides more flexibility in finishing materials than partially or fully recessed models, which must be affixed to the studs.

Flames

A wall-mounted electric fireplace can add modern, warm and wall Fireplace electric cozy ambience to any space. It can also provide additional heating to keep living spaces warm in the winter months. Fireplaces are practical and can save people money by providing an inexpensive alternative to traditional gas line-powered heating systems. They also decrease the amount of harmful pollution in the home and are in line with the latest environmental standards.

The majority of electrical fireplaces provide a realistic flame presentation and a beautiful bed of embers. Some models have multicolored flames, which are designed to mimic natural flames that a fireplace produces. Most models come with a useful remote that can be used to alter the settings.

Some people choose an electric fireplace that is flush mounted so it can be placed flat against any wall. Some people prefer a recessed electric fireplace which can be built into the wall for an individual fit as well as added depth. Both options will require brackets and hardware for mounting. If you intend to install a recessed unit, it is recommended to enlist the help of a professional make sure the installation is done right.

Another factor to consider is the power capacity of the fireplace. You'll want to select one that is energy efficient and rated high BTUs. This will keep you from paying any unexpected energy charges.

When shopping for a wall-mounted electric fireplace look for a broad selection of frame finishes and colors to complement your decor. There are many brands that provide a wide variety of front face colors. These include sleek black or contemporary stainless steel. You can choose one with top venting for an individualized look, or one that is completely flush with the wall.

Many models come with cool glass technology, which prevents the surface getting too hot. This allows them to be used in homes with pets or children. The technology is based on drawing cool air from the space and spreading it evenly. The embers and fire are displayed in a pleasing manner, without having to worry about burns or wall heat.

Heat

In contrast to traditional fireplaces that rely on logs and coal wall mounted electric fireplaces feature a heating element on the bottom that allows warm air into a room. This makes them ideal for those who would like warm and cosy fires within their home but can't utilize a real fireplace due to lack of space or restrictions regarding where they can place it.

The majority of models come with an electric heater that can generate up to 5,000 BTUs of additional heating in wall electric fireplaces rooms that range from 400 square feet in size. The flame's color and brightness can be altered to suit your preferences. Some models are equipped with an easy-to-use timer.

When choosing a wall-mounted electric fireplace, it is crucial to determine whether the fireplace will be freestanding or recessing into the wall. Freestanding models let you select the location of your installation, while recessed models must be fixed to the wall over drywall and require professional installation. There are a few easy steps that you can take to ensure a smooth and quick installation, irrespective of the method.

Before beginning the installation process, make sure your fireplace is working properly. Plug it in and test the heat and lights to be certain everything works correctly. After you've done this, locate the best spot on the wall and begin the mounting process. The first step is to attach the bracket on the bottom of the wall by placing it on slots or hooks on the back of the fireplace. Then, align slots on the backside of the fireplace using the brackets' hooks and insert hooks into slots to fix the fireplace to Wall fireplace electric.

When you install your new wall mounted electric fireplace, remember that you must keep all combustible objects at least three feet from the unit. This will decrease the chance of a fire, by making combustible materials more difficult to ignite if they're too close. Moreover, you should never restrict the vents of your fireplace. The vents are designed to allow a regular flow of hot air and fresh air. This helps the fireplace operate more efficiently and also prevents overheating.

Safety

A lot of wall-mounted electric fireplaces have a protective screen that remains at a low temperature throughout the fireplace's use and prevents burns. They operate and keep the temperature at lower temperatures than traditional fireplaces. This makes them suitable for homes with pets and children. Some models have special features, like the fire-only mode, which allows you enjoy the appearance of a fire, but without the heat.

imageElectric fireplaces are generally intended to be used as a source of heating rather than primary heating. To ensure safety and correct operation, it is essential to follow the instructions that come with your model. Make sure that you keep the area around your fireplace clear of combustible material and unobstructed by furniture or drapes. It is essential to keep anything that could ignite at least three feet away from the fireplace in order to reduce the risk of fire and allow for the circulation of hot air.
